Is Mercedes still owned by Chrysler?

Daimler-Benz was formed with the merger of Benz & Cie. and Daimler Motoren Gesellschaft in 1926. The company was renamed DaimlerChrysler upon acquiring the American automobile manufacturer Chrysler Corporation in 1998, and was again renamed Daimler AG upon divestment of Chrysler in 2007.

Who makes Cadillac?

On July 29, 1909, the newly formed General Motors Corporation (GM) acquires the country's leading luxury automaker, the Cadillac Automobile Company, for $4.5 million.

Who owns Mini Cooper?

BMW owns MINI Cooper, and BMW's owned MINI Cooper for some time now. MINI Cooper was bought out by BMW in 2000. Before BMW's acquisition, the Rover Group owned MINI. BMW bought the Rover Group in 1994, and BMW then broke up the group in 2000, retaining the MINI badge.

Who makes Porsche?

Porsche and Volkswagen merged in 2011. At that time, Porsche was designated a subsidiary of Volkswagen AG (interestingly, besides being the Porsche parent company, VW also owns Audi, Bugatti, and Lamborghini). So, from that standpoint, Volkswagen AG is the company who owns Porsche.

Why is it called G-Wagon?

The new Mercedes-Benz four-wheel-drive was called the “G-Wagen”, with the “G” standing for “Geländewagen” (which translates as “off-road vehicle” or “land wagon”, much like Rover's “Land Rover”).
